Output 163e8414eb08a726a9e42738e5be72c4a6eb42c6dbd82a6394d3a3266f50baaf:6

value
1953327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2fb11d1c95f548a07b23c0e65cd0bc243f70d9 OP_EQUAL
address
3HCsvqqPgf8qS6iEJqZ3AMXhWR7TTtRUrs
transaction
163e8414eb08a726a9e42738e5be72c4a6eb42c6dbd82a6394d3a3266f50baaf
spent
true